Nurse’s Helping Hands is a 50-bed, family-owned assisted living and memory care home. The facility focuses on providing daily support and specialized dementia care programming structured around the needs of residents experiencing cognitive decline.
Government oversight records covering a 12-year timeline document 32 total deficiencies across 25 separate evaluations, an annual average of 1.2 citations that performs 74% better than the Florida state baseline. Out of those 25 visits, 17 came back entirely clear, meaning the home has maintained a high zero citations-per-inspection rate across the majority of its reviews. The facility experienced an isolated operational hurdle in February 2022 when a complaint visit flagged a peak cluster of eight deficiencies involving resident supervision, medication help, and staffing rules.
Management quickly corrected those issues, securing five consecutive clear inspections through early 2024. While a mid-2023 complaint evaluation noted a brief slip with three infractions regarding elopement standards and training, the most recent April 2025 routine inspection returned to a completely clean record. The state has never issued fines or severe enforcement penalties against the provider.
Prospective residents and their representatives can view this long-term history as a sign of resilient compliance and steady management. Because the data shows that occasional spikes in staffing or medication documentation are quickly self-corrected by the team, the overall records indicate a well-monitored environment. Inspection Reports Summary
An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.
- April 9, 2025 standard inspection found no deficiencies and no complaints.
- February 9, 2022 complaint inspection cited eight Class 3 deficiencies including resident care, medication assistance, staffing, training, records, background screening, and emergency management.
- June 5, 2023 complaint inspection found three deficiencies related to admissions, resident care, and staff training.
